Choosing the Right Wood for Your Console Table

Choosing the right wood sets the tone and durability of your console table from the start. We’ll guide you through options that balance look, strength, and workability. Hardwoods like oak, maple, and walnut resist dents and aging well, but they come with higher cost and heavier weight. Softer options like pine or poplar are friendlier to beginners and easier to shape, yet show wear sooner. Consider grain pattern and color, since these define character as it ages. We weigh stability, dimensional tolerance, and finish compatibility, especially for moisture-prone areas. We should also factor availability and sustainability, favoring responsibly sourced, local stock when possible. Finally, match wood to the intended style and the hardware you’ll use, ensuring a cohesive, lasting result.

Cutting, Joinery, and Assembly Basics

To start cutting, we’ll choose solid stock that’s straight and square, then plan each cut to minimize waste and maximize strength. We approach joinery with purpose: mortise and tenon for frame connections, dowels or biscuits for panel alignment, and robust fasteners where needed. We mark all cuts clearly, double-checking angles and references before committing to a saw.

Dry-fit assemblies guide us, letting us tweak dimensions and ensure squareness without forcing parts. We prioritize clean edges, square shoulders, and consistent thickness so panels glide together smoothly.

When assembling, we use clamps to hold parts while glue cures, and we wipe excess glue promptly to avoid interference with movement. Finally, we inspect joints for alignment, adjusting as required to deliver a sturdy, lasting console table.

Smoothing, Sanding, and Surface Preparation

Now that our components are cut and joined, we turn to smoothing, sanding, and surface preparation to reveal clean, ready-to-finish edges. We begin with a coarser grit to even out tool marks, then progress to finer grits for a uniform surface. Our goal is consistency across tops and rails, so we sand with the grain wherever possible and rotate the piece to maintain flatness. We wipe away dust between stages to see true results. If gouges appear, we fill them with a lightweight wood filler, letting it cure before sanding flush. We inspect edges for sharpness, rounding corners slightly to avoid catching finish. Finally, we vacuum and tack-wipe, ensuring a dust-free base for the next steps.

Designing Sturdy Stand Geometry and Dimensions

How can we ensure a display stand remains rigid and level across varied loads and surfaces? We start with a solid base that distributes weight evenly, then choose geometry that resists tipping. A low center of gravity helps stability, so we favor wider stance and diagonal bracing rather than tall, slender forms. We design legs with slight outward splay and consider adjustable feet for uneven floors. Use perimeter support rails to transfer loads smoothly into the base, and ensure joints align flush to prevent binding. Material choice matters: consistent thicknesses and grain direction reduce warping, while balanced panels avoid twisting. We test with incremental loads to verify stiffness, then document dimensions for repeatability. Precise measurement, deliberate cut patterns, and careful sanding finish the design.

Sanding, Finishing, and Protecting the Wood

Sanding, finishing, and protecting the wood is where the handle truly comes to life. We start by smoothing the surface in even strokes, moving from 120 to 220 grit for a glassy feel. We wipe dust, then inspect for blemishes, filling any tiny pores or dents as needed. Next, we choose a finish that suits daily use—polyurethane for durability, or tung oil for warmth—and apply thin coats, letting each dry fully before light sanding with 320 grit. We test a sample on scrap to confirm color and sheen. We seal edges to guard against moisture and wear. Finally, we polish with a soft cloth, removing residues, so the grip stays smooth and protected as it ages.

Measuring and Planning for the Perfect Fit

How do we ensure the dog house fits just right? We start by measuring the dog’s height from floor to top of head when seated, then add clearance for growth and a comfortable ramp.

Next, we gauge length from nose to tail while seated, adding space for bedding and a doorway that won’t trap their shoulders.

We consider door height, width, and sill height to keep drafts out without restricting movement.

We plan interior dimensions that allow bedding, a water dish, and small storage for toys.

We sketch a simple layout, noting how air flow and sun exposure affect comfort.

Finally, we create a material list tuned to precise measurements, avoiding waste and ensuring a sturdy, weatherproof shell that’s easy to assemble.
